Modificar Cadena de Conexión

23/06/2006 - 23:36 por zantos | Informe spam
hola quisiera saber si alguien me podría ayudar con ésto, yo quisiera cambiar
la cadena de conexíon dentro del app.config, estaba enterado que era facil...
pero intenté de la siguiente forma:
my.setting.CadenaConexion = "c:\xxx..."
Pero como pensaba: property 'CadenaConexión' is 'read only'

cómo podría modificarla??

desde ya muchas gracias
santi.

Preguntas similare

Leer las respuestas

#6 SoftJaén
26/06/2006 - 08:51 | Informe spam
Leyendo de nuevo tu mensaje, puede ser que te refieras a que has editado el
archivo «Settings.settings» con cualquier editor de texto, como por ejemplo,
el Bloc de Notas.

Si sabes bien lo que haces, se puede modificar el archivo directamente
porque se trata de un documento en formato XML, y por tanto, es texto plano,
por lo que puedes dejar el bloque de la declaración de propiedad de la
siguiente manera:

<Setting Name="CadenaConexion" Type="System.String" Scope="User">
<Value Profile="(Default)">Tu cadena de conexión</Value>
</Setting>

Por supuesto, deberás de guardar los cambios para que surtan efecto.

Pero si no entiendes muy bien los entresijos del entorno de diseño de Visual
Studio 2005, aunque hayas modificado el valor, éste no surtirá efecto hasta
que no edites la página de configuración en el diseñador de proyectos, tal y
como te he indicado en el mensaje anterior.

Aparte, si has modificado el archivo con un editor externo, al abrir la
página de configuración en el diseñador de proyectos, te aparecerá un cuadro
de mensaje informativo preguntándote si deseas actualizar el valor del
archivo .Settings. En éste supuesto, deberás de seleccionar el botón NO,
para que en la página de configuración aparezca el valor de «Usuario» (o
«User» en la versión inglesa).

Pero la propiedad seguirá siendo de «sólo lectura» hasta que no guardes los
valores de la página de propiedades desde el propio entorno de Visual Studio
2005, bien seleccionando la opción Archivo --> Guardar My
Project\Settings.settings, o pulsando el clásico icono correspondiente a la
opción de «Guardar».

Por tanto, se aconseja modificar las propiedades de configuración desde el
propio entorno de Visual Studio, y evitar en la medida de lo posible editar
el archivo con cualquier editor de texto que tengamos a mano. :-)

Enrique Martínez
[MS MVP - VB]

Nota informativa: La información contenida en este mensaje, así como el
código fuente incluido en el mismo, se proporciona «COMO ESTÁ», sin
garantías de ninguna clase, y no otorga derecho alguno. Usted asume
cualquier riesgo al poner en práctica, utilizar o ejecutar lo recomendado o
sugerido en el presente mensaje.
Respuesta Responder a este mensaje
#7 zantos
26/06/2006 - 21:01 | Informe spam
Gracias nuevamente por la ayuda, la verdad que no podría haberlo hecho sólo.

santi.
email Siga el debate Respuesta Responder a este mensaje
Ads by Google
Help Hacer una pregunta AnteriorRespuesta Tengo una respuesta
Search Busqueda sugerida